Daniel Stendel, Gareth Ainsworth and Paul Cook are reportedly among the managerial candidates at Sunderland.

Stephen Elliott has suggested Wigan Athletic manager Paul Cook as the new boss of Sunderland, as posted on Twitter.
The former Sunderland forward believes that out of Daniel Stendel, Gareth Ainsworth and Cook, the Wigan boss is the best candidate for the Black Cats’ managerial role.
According to The Telegraph, Wycombe Wanderers manager Gareth is the favourite for the Sunderland managerial position and has been given permission to speak to the Black Cats.
The report has also claimed that former Barnsley boss Stendal and current Wigan manager Cook are under consideration by the Stadium of Light outfit.
